Mirobriga or Mirobriga of the Celts was an ancient town in the westernmost part of Lusitania during the Iron Age and Roman Times that was mentioned by Pliny the Elder and Ptolemy.

The Igreja Matriz de Santiago do Cacém is a 13th century church, of the invocation of Santiago Maior, located in the town of Santiago do Cacém, Portugal. Igreja Matriz de Santiago do Cacém is situated 1 km southwest of Parque do Cerro Maior.
